Jingren Palace, Palace in China
Jingren Palace, part of the Forbidden City, features a stunning example of Ming dynasty architecture.
The construction of Jingren Palace was completed in 1420 during the reign of Emperor Yongle.
Jingren Palace served as the residence for successive empresses during the Ming and Qing dynasties.
Visitors can admire Jingren Palace as part of a tour of the larger Forbidden City complex.
